Output 73c66bc99721ac65eaa5d31f2672b5e730e936761a3b531feac62262696546c5:25

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 cf6f937f6ef50dea7ca4bf049daf0a90a20c547d
address
tb1qeahexlmw75x75l9yhuzfmtc2jz3qc4ra57tm2t
transaction
73c66bc99721ac65eaa5d31f2672b5e730e936761a3b531feac62262696546c5